Discovering What to Say Poetry and a son who wouldby Wally Swist This collection of 39 poems, written over five years, chronicles the profound passages of later lifelove deepened by loss, the solace found in nature, and the weight of memory. Written as the author's spouse, Tevis, lives with Alzheimer's in care, these verses don't dwell on illness but instead reveal how a life fully lived continues to discover what matters most.
